Once award-winning cop held on child porn charges

An award-winning Florida police officer was charged Wednesday with distributing and receiving child pornography after an undercover investigation. 

Port St. Lucie Officer Michael Harding, who once won the award for “Officer of the Year,” is accused of posting explicit images online through a smartphone app Kik, NBC News reported. Location data showed he was in his police cruiser on duty at the time.

Further investigation led to a thumb drive in Harding’s home containing “hundreds of images and videos of children engaged in sexually explicit conduct,” inside a gun case in his bedroom closet.

“If these allegations are true, this is very disturbing,” Port St. Lucie Police Chief John Bolduc told WPTV.

The married father of three was named “Officer of the Year” in 2011 while employed by the Fort Pierce police department. Harding has been an officer with Port St. Lucie since 2012.
